Summaryinfo

A vulnerability has been found in Google Android 8.0/8.1 and classified as critical. Impacted is the function writeToParcel/readFromParcel of the file PeriodicAdvertisingReport.java. The manipulation leads to access control. This vulnerability is traded as CVE-2017-13288. An attack has to be approached locally. There is no exploit available. It is suggested to install a patch to address this issue.

Detailsinfo

A vulnerability, which was classified as critical, has been found in Google Android 8.0/8.1 (Smartphone Operating System). This issue affects the function writeToParcel/readFromParcel of the file PeriodicAdvertisingReport.java.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a access control vulnerability. Using CWE to declare the problem leads to CWE-264. Impacted is confidentiality, integrity, and availability. The summary by CVE is:

In writeToParcel and readFromParcel of PeriodicAdvertisingReport.java, there is a permission bypass due to a 64/32bit int mismatch. This could lead to a local escalation of privilege where the user can start an activity with system privileges, with no additional execution privileges needed. User interaction is not needed for exploitation. Product: Android. Versions: 8.0, 8.1. Android ID: A-69634768.

The bug was discovered 04/05/2018. The weakness was shared 04/04/2018 (Website). The advisory is shared at source.android.com. The identification of this vulnerability is CVE-2017-13288 since 08/23/2017. The exploitation is known to be easy. An attack has to be approached locally. No form of authentication is needed for a successful exploitation. Technical details are known, but no exploit is available. MITRE ATT&CK project uses the attack technique T1068 for this issue.

Applying a patch is able to eliminate this problem.
